The illustrated history of football world cup 1930-2018, brings together the best moments of all the football world cups. The book showcases distinctive caricatures of the most iconic players, the most spectacular goals and the most poignant scenes, accompanied by facts and gripping background stories.

An illustrated history of the essendon football club captures the essence of one of the great vfl/afl clubs, in words and images. Using previously unpublished photographs from club and other archives, and complemented by artifacts, memorabilia and strong editorial, the book outlines the club's rich history, from a suburban entity to a national powerhouse on and off the field.
